Can Lavender Handle Full Sun. Some varieties of lavender perform well in sunny spots, while others may prefer sun but can still handle some shade. Lavender will produce less fragrant flowers if not given enough sunlight. If lavender doesn’t get enough sun, its flowers might be smaller. Lavender grown in shade is susceptible to root rot. Many species of lavender will grow in partial shade and exhibit moderate shade tolerance, but vigor and full blooms are hard to come by in such conditions. Lavender plants prefer full sun exposure, which means they thrive when exposed to direct sunlight for the majority of the day. Is lavender a sun or shade plant? Full sun is the default. Plant lavender in a spot with at least 6 to 8 hours of sunlight each day (“full sun”). Amend compacted or clay soil with compost or aged manure to improve drainage.
